-
题名现代软件开发方法中的use case技术
被引量:4
- 1
-
-
作者
刘作伟
宁洪
-
机构
国防科技大学计算机学院
-
出处
《计算机科学》
CSCD
北大核心
1999年第4期70-74,共5页
-
文摘
1 引言在面向对象的软件开发方法中.客户关心的是软件系统的功能,而开发人员的工作是围绕目标软件系统中的对象来进行的。为了把软件系统的对象模型和功能模型有机地结合起来,在众多的面向对象开发方法中都采用了一种称为“use case”的技术。use case的分析、设计和实现与面向对象的分析、设计和实现结合起来,提供了一种贯穿整个软件生命周期的开发方式,使得软件开发的各个阶段的工作自然、一致地协调起来。在UML系统建模规范中,更把use case做为其中的一个重要组成部分。下面以UML中的相关模型为例,介绍use case技术。
-
关键词
面向对象
软件开发方法
usecase技术
-
Keywords
use case,actor,software model,object
-
分类号
TP311.52
[自动化与计算机技术—计算机软件与理论]
-
-
题名现代软件开发方法中的Use Case技术
被引量:1
- 2
-
-
作者
刘作伟
宁洪
-
机构
国防科技大学计算机学院
-
出处
《计算机工程与科学》
CSCD
1999年第4期32-35,共4页
-
基金
CCX基金
-
文摘
现代软件开发方法普遍采用了UseCase驱动的方法。本文依据UML1.1规范,首先介绍UseCase的有关概念,然后介绍分析、设计和实现UseCase的过程,重点阐述UseCase的描述、细化和实现的有关细节,最后强调了分析、设计和实现UseCase过程中应该注意的一些问题。
-
关键词
use
case
软件模型
软件开发
面向对象
-
Keywords
use case,actor,software model,object.
-
分类号
TP311.52
[自动化与计算机技术—计算机软件与理论]
-
-
题名一个支持软件过程的CASE系统的设计与实现
被引量:10
- 3
-
-
作者
黄日日
杨芙清
-
机构
北京大学计算机科学与技术系
-
出处
《计算机学报》
EI
CSCD
北大核心
1997年第5期441-450,共10页
-
文摘
本文阐述了一个支持多用户协同式软件工程活动的CASE系统(PCS)的设计与实现,提出了一种“组工作模型”及其相关的软件支持设施,包括过程支持设施、角色支持设施以及对象库支持设施等.
-
关键词
协同式
软件工程
case
过程模型
-
Keywords
Cooperative software engineering activities
case
process model
role model
object repository
-
分类号
TP311.5
[自动化与计算机技术—计算机软件与理论]
-
-
题名软件需求分析中的用例建模研究与应用
被引量:12
- 4
-
-
作者
许海燕
张小东
-
机构
哈尔滨工业大学(威海)计算机科学与技术学院
-
出处
《计算机工程与设计》
CSCD
北大核心
2007年第18期4504-4506,共3页
-
基金
山东省科技发展计划基金项目(2002-276-022090104)。
-
文摘
需求是软件项目的基础,如何把握用户需求,是项目成功与否的关键。一个灵活的软件需求分析技术,可以帮助开发人员准确获取用户需求。用例建模是面向对象软件开发技术的重要组成内容,它能够完整地捕捉系统的功能性需求,体现用户和系统之间的交互关系。通过一个实例分析,简要介绍如何使用用例建模技术,完成软件需求分析。
-
关键词
用例
用例建模
用例模型
软件需求
参与者
-
Keywords
use case
use case modeling use case model
software requirement
actor
-
分类号
TP311
[自动化与计算机技术—计算机软件与理论]
-
-
题名基于UML的嵌入式软件测试用例生成方法研究
被引量:8
- 5
-
-
作者
殷永峰
刘斌
姜同敏
-
机构
北京航空航天大学工程系统工程系
-
出处
《计算机应用研究》
CSCD
北大核心
2008年第10期3018-3021,共4页
-
基金
国家"十一五"国防预研基金资助项目(513190701)
-
文摘
基于嵌入式软件实时性、嵌入式和反应式等特点,对UML进行了实时性扩展,运用多种UML视图描述嵌入式系统的结构和行为,提出了如何从基于UML的模型中自动生成测试用例的设计思路。
-
关键词
统一建模语言
面向对象
嵌入式软件
测试场景
测试用例
-
Keywords
UML(unified modeling language)
object-oriented
embedded software
test scenario
test case
-
分类号
TP311
[自动化与计算机技术—计算机软件与理论]
-
-
题名软件功能需求变化传播机理分析
被引量:6
- 6
-
-
作者
王映辉
-
机构
西安理工大学计算机科学与工程学院
-
出处
《计算机学报》
EI
CSCD
北大核心
2007年第11期2025-2032,共8页
-
基金
国家国家"九七三"重点基础研究发展规划项目基金(2001AA113171)
陕西省自然科学基金(2007F51)
陕西省教育厅科技攻关项目(07JK348)资助.~~
-
文摘
软件变化控制是软件开发者历来追求的目标,也是研究软件演化的基础.基于功能需求变化,描述了变化用况和变化对象的标识,阐明了变化构件的界定策略,给出了SA(Software Architecture)中变化信息的追踪方法;同时分析了软件变化转播在软件生命周期中的一些重要性质;最后描绘了本文研究的整体框架和一个应用实例.对软件演化与维护具有一定的借鉴意义.
-
关键词
用况
对象模型
变化传播
软件演化
变化分析
-
Keywords
use case
object model
change propagation
software evolution
change analysis
-
分类号
TP311
[自动化与计算机技术—计算机软件与理论]
-
-
题名扩展用例驱动技术在软件系统中的分析与应用
- 7
-
-
作者
严熙
沙佰荣
郑威
-
机构
江苏科技大学电子信息学院
-
出处
《现代电子技术》
北大核心
2016年第8期33-36,共4页
-
基金
国家自然科学基金:高维数据保真降维方法研究(61471182)
-
文摘
当前成熟的软件系统分析与设计方法大多关注于软件系统的功能性,而可信性并未得到充分的考虑。随着软件本身及其运行环境日渐复杂,功能实现过程中软件的可信性引起人们越来越多的关注。为了构建出既满足功能性需求又满足可信性需求的对象模型,提出一种扩展用例驱动的设计方法,运用现有开发方法 ICONIX方法,对软件分析设计过程中的健壮性分析过程进行扩展。引入一种新的用例来实现软件功能性和可行性的结合,并最终得出所需对象模型。
-
关键词
软件分析
可信性
扩展用例
对象模型
-
Keywords
software analysis
credibility
extended use case
object model
-
分类号
TN911-34
[电子电信—通信与信息系统]
TP311
[自动化与计算机技术—计算机软件与理论]
-
-
题名基于UML的CPN模型在软件测试中的应用
被引量:5
- 8
-
-
作者
刘烁
陈俊杰
-
机构
太原理工大学计算机与软件学院
-
出处
《计算机工程》
CAS
CSCD
北大核心
2008年第3期119-121,共3页
-
文摘
UML在被工业界广泛接受的同时也成为学术界遵循的一种标准建模语言。许多面向对象软件测试的研究都围绕UML模型开展。但UML模型属于半形式化模型,往往无法自动生成测试用例。将UML模型与Petri网相结合,能够弥补其数学支持的不足。文章给出了基于UML的CPN模型的测试框架和一个从UML模型构造CPN模型的算法,并根据该方法给出了自动化支持工具U2CPN的类图结构。
-
关键词
面向对象软件测试
统一建模语言
着色PETRI网
测试用例生成
-
Keywords
object-oriented software test
Unified modeling Language(UML)
colored Petri nets
test cases generation
-
分类号
TP311.5
[自动化与计算机技术—计算机软件与理论]
-